EPISODE TITLE: Episode 64: More Myths Revisited

ORIGINAL AIR DATE:10/25/2006

SYNOPSIS: Returning to the most controversial myths, "Myths Revisited" offers Jamie and Adam the chance to clear their names. Watch as they repeat past experiments to see if their original answer was genuine or bogus. There's laughter, danger and attitude as the MythBusters fight for their rights.




Myths Features in This Episode

Myth #1: Salami Rocket Revisited
Can you use a salami as rocket fuel?

Myth #2: Rough Road Driving Revisited
Can you holding your hand against a windshield to prevent rocks from shattering it?

Myth #3: Tailgate Up or Down Revisited
In addition to tailgate up/down, also tested hardcover over pickup bed, tailgate removed, and tailgate mesh.

Myth #4: Cutting a Sword Revisited
During WWII, Japanese soldiers were able to slice American machine gun barrels in half.
